Artificial intelligence (AI) has become a popular word in recent years, seen across headlines and product descriptions. But is AI a genuine revolution in various industries, or just a marketing ploy to sell more products? Let’s explore the role of AI and see whether it’s a technical necessity or marketing gimmick!

Technical Advantage

There’s no denying AI’s transformative potential for businesses. It’s creating wonders for industries that have been using outdated methods of running business operations.

  • Data Analysis: AI’s strong suite is crunching massive datasets, uncovering patterns and trends to provide the analysis that is impossible for a human to decode. In finance, for example, AI can predict market fluctuations and optimize investment strategies.
  • Automation: Repetitive tasks can be automated by AI-powered tools. Today, chatbots are handling customer service inquiries, allowing human agents to focus on complex problem-solving.
  • Machine Learning: AI learns and improves over time, constantly refining its abilities. In healthcare, AI can analyze medical images to detect diseases with high accuracy, aiding in early diagnosis.

This is just a glimpse of what AI is capable of. However, the more the hype, the more businesses try to take advantage of the trending technologies.

The Flip Side: Marketing Factor

While AI holds immense potential, there are situations where it might be overhyped:

  • Misusing AI for Marketing: Some companies might slap an “AI-powered” label on a product with minimal actual AI integration. This can be misleading and damage consumer trust.
  • Focus on Buzz, Not Benefits: The emphasis might be on the “AI” aspect rather than the practical advantages it brings. Companies should highlight how AI improves the user experience or solves a specific problem.

Finding the Right Balance

AI is a powerful tool, but it’s not everything for a business. The key is to implement AI strategically, focusing on its strengths and impacts:

  • Identify genuine needs: Does AI truly address a challenge or automate a tedious task? Evaluate if a simpler solution might suffice.
  • Transparency is key: If you’re using AI, be upfront about it. Explain how AI enhances the product or service.

The Future of AI

AI is here to stay, and its applications will continue to evolve. By focusing on its technical capabilities and using it responsibly, AI can revolutionize numerous industries. However, we must be cautious of marketing gimmicks and ensure AI is used ethically and transparently.
